"All roads lead to Nihonbashi"
The area of Nihonbashi gathers the headquarters of some of the most important corporations in Japan. But don't be deceived by the modern look of its tall skyscrapers. This area is the oldest part of the city and gathers a unique blend of modern and old architecture.

The walk will focus on experiencing the richness of Japanese culture by visiting old craft shops, hidden shrines, and the oldest landmarks in town. We will also eat traditional Japanese desserts in a 7th generation 150 years old maker!

Come for a history tour of the past, present, and future of the Nihonbashi area.
Throughout the visit, we will see how the city has modernized while protecting its old traditions in a unique cultural blend.
